US: "Hope springs eternal in Philly"

Fresh off a Super Bowl win, Philadelphia is a party town. Suntory will be there for the ultimate garden party, the Philadelphia Flower Show, March 1-9. This will be our fifth year supporting Botanical Artist Tu Bloom's potting parties, where he will engage more than 2,700 consumers in hands-on planting activities – as many as 75 people at a time, four times a day.

The popular workshop draws a diverse mix of participants spanning generations – families, friends, parents with children, spouses, lovers and singles. Companies have even reserved slots for team building. This year's Suntory varieties are Senetti and Granvia plants grown locally by Peace Tree Farm.

This year's assortment of varieties:

Granvia Bracteantha
Super strawflowers offer three seasons of color. "Harvest blooms for dried floral crafts."

Senetti Pericallis
"Early spring is the perfect time to plant Senetti along with other cold-tolerant annuals. Baby varieties are more compact with smaller blooms."
